Typical Window Issues
Before diving into the repair procedure, it's important to understand the common issues that may require customized window repair:
- Leaky Windows: Water seepage can trigger damage to the surrounding structure and cause mold growth.
- Drafty Windows: Air leakages can make your home feel unpleasant and boost energy expenses.
- Broken Glass: Cracked or shattered glass can pose a safety threat and minimize the energy effectiveness of your windows.
- Sticking Windows: Windows that are tough to open or close can be a nuisance and may show underlying concerns.
- Rotted Wood: Wooden window frames can degrade over time, particularly in humid environments.
- Faulty Hardware: Broken or damaged hardware can avoid windows from functioning properly.
Actions Involved in Custom Window Repair
Customized window repair is a meticulous process that involves a number of actions to ensure the very best possible outcome:
Assessment and Diagnosis
- Evaluation: An expert will completely examine your windows to identify the particular problems.
- Diagnosis: Based on the inspection, the expert will identify the issues and recommend the essential repairs.
Product Selection
- Quality Materials: High-quality products are important for a durable and efficient repair. This consists of glass, wood, and hardware.
- Custom Fit: Custom materials are picked to match the distinct dimensions and style of your windows.
Repair Process
- Disassembly: The damaged elements are thoroughly gotten rid of to avoid further damage.
- Repair or Replacement: Depending on the extent of the damage, the expert will either repair or replace the afflicted parts.
- Reassembly: The fixed or replaced parts are reinstalled, ensuring an ideal fit and function.
Sealing and Finishing
- Sealing: Any spaces or leakages are sealed to guarantee airtight and watertight performance.
- Ending up: The fixed windows are finished to match the existing aesthetic, guaranteeing a smooth look.
Checking and Quality Assurance
- Functionality Test: The windows are checked to guarantee they open, close, and lock correctly.
- Quality Check: A last evaluation is conducted to make sure that all repairs meet the greatest standards.
